Formal training is not a job requirement for cooks, as you can study on the job. However, formal schooling is essential if you are keen on making a mark on this field.

In basic, culinary programs provided by neighborhood colleges value less than packages at four-yr institutions. Additionally, some packages provide tuition reductions to in-state college students. Learners can benefit from financial assist alternatives, like scholarships and grants, to offset annual tuition costs. Many culinary colleges offer electives or specializations, such as hospitality management, that allow students to tailor the diploma to their objectives and pursuits. Formal culinary education prepares graduates for skilled certifications and competitive jobs in the meals companies trade.
